No sooner the PDP man won the primary election than he signed a million dollar deal with an international publicist, Ballard Partners—a firm founded by Florida-based lobbyist, Brian Ballard who’s believed to be working with the US President, Donald Trump.

And as if that’s not enough, Alhaji Atiku’s entourage was lodged at the US President’s family hotel, Trump International hotel, a clear indication that, the seeds are in place for a soft landing.
